    摘要: A chip-type electronic component with high reliability, which is able to suppress and prevent fatal damage to a ceramic body due to cracking even if a substrate with the chip-type electronic component mounted thereon undergoes a deflection. The chip-type electronic component includes a ceramic body having internal electrodes; resin electrode layers formed in a region including at least end surfaces of the ceramic body, and connected to the internal electrodes directly or indirectly and connected with the ceramic body; and plating metal layers covering the resin electrode layers, wherein the adhesion strength between the ceramic body and the resin electrode layer is higher than the adhesion strength between the resin electrode layer and the plating metal layer.

    摘要: When an external terminal electrode of a ceramic electronic component such as a laminated ceramic capacitor is formed by plating, plating growth may be also caused even in an undesired location. The ceramic surface provided by a component main body is configured to include a high plating growth region of, for example, a barium titanate based ceramic, which exhibits relatively high plating growth, and a low plating growth region of, for example, a calcium zirconate based ceramic, which exhibits relatively low plating growth. The plating film constituting a first layer to define a base for an external terminal electrode is formed in such a way that the growth of a plated deposit deposited with conductive surfaces provided by exposed ends of internal electrodes as starting points is limited so as not to cross over a boundary between the high plating growth region and the low plating growth region toward the low plating growth region.

    摘要: A flexible substrate is wound around a magnetic core to define an antenna coil. A receiver coil including a first receiver coil portion and a second receiver coil portion which have opposite winding directions, and a transmitter coil including a first transmitter coil portion and a second transmitter coil portion which have opposite winding directions are provided on the flexible substrate. A region in which the receiver coil is provided and a region in which the transmitter coil is provided at least partially overlap each other when viewed in plan view, and non-coil-wound portions are provided between the first coil portions and second coil portions in the coils.

    摘要: A dielectric antenna is provided which uses a compounded material and exhibits a small change in relative dielectric constant at room temperature against a load due to temperature changes. The dielectric antenna includes a dielectric block, a radiation electrode, a feeding electrode and a fixing electrode provided on the dielectric block. The dielectric block contains a crystalline thermoplastic resin, ceramic powder, and an acid-modified styrenic thermoplastic elastomer. The acid-modified styrenic thermoplastic elastomer content in the dielectric block is 3% to 20% by volume.

    摘要: In an electronic component, a laminate includes a plurality of laminated ceramic layers and a mounting surface defined by outer edges of the plurality of laminated ceramic layers, the outer edges being continuously located adjacent to each other. Capacitor conductors are disposed on the ceramic layers and include exposed portions that are exposed at the mounting surface between the ceramic layers. An electroconductive layer defining an external electrode is arranged to directly cover the exposed portions and is formed by plating so as to be made of plated material. Another electroconductive layer covers the above-mentioned electroconductive layer and partially covers surfaces of the laminate, and it is made of a material including metal and one of glass and resin.

    摘要: A method for manufacturing a laminated electronic component in which, when first plating layers that respectively connect a plurality of internal electrodes to each other and second plating layers that improves the mountability of a laminated electronic component are formed as external terminal electrodes, the entire component main body is treated with a water repellent agent after the formation of the first plating layers, and the water repellent agent on the first plating layers is then removed before the formation of the second plating layers. The gaps between the end edges of the first plating films on the outer surface of the component main body and the outer surface of the component main body are filled with the water repellent agent.
